Overview: Sigma Analytics and Phrazor as Business Intelligence Category solutions.
Sigma Analytics offers robust capabilities in sales and customer management, with features that suit enterprise and mid-market segments in diverse industries, including IT. In contrast, Phrazor excels in competitive intelligence and marketing analytics, appealing more to mid-market businesses in financial and banking sectors. Sigma Analytics supports operational workflows across scales with extensive collaboration tools, whereas Phrazor leverages AI and analytics to align with performance-driven goals, emphasizing ROI improvement and sales growth.
Sigma Analytics: Sigma-analytics, Sigma Computing is a cloud-based BI platform that transforms data into insights. Business decisions are elevated by analyzing data at scale for opportunities.
Phrazor: Phrazor, an AI-powered platform, simplifies business reports with insightful narratives. Reporting automation and business intelligence are enhanced using natural language generation.

Latest Sigma Analytics News
Sigma Launches New Process Effectiveness Solution with Snowflake to Power AI-Driven Energy Operations | Sigma
Sigma Computing and Snowflake have launched a new process effectiveness solution aimed at enhancing AI-driven operations in the energy sector. This collaboration provides a unified data foundation, enabling energy companies to optimize yield, improve operational resilience, and reduce emissions by integrating IT, OT, and IoT data. The solution supports real-time market-aware operations and democratizes expert analysis, allowing for more efficient and secure energy infrastructure.
